<!doctype html> <html>
时间: 2024-04-06 13:27:41 浏览: 76
<!doctype html>是HTML文档的声明,它告诉浏览器使用哪个HTML版本来解析页面。具体来说,<!doctype html>声明告诉浏览器使用HTML5版本来解析页面。HTML5是最新的HTML标准,它引入了许多新的功能和语法,使得开发者可以更好地构建现代化的网页应用程序。
下面是一个简单的HTML文档示例,其中包含了<!doctype html>声明:
```html
<!doctype html>
<html>
<head>
<title>My First HTML Page</title>
</head>
<body>
<h1>Hello, World!</h1>
<p>This is my first HTML page.</p>
</body>
</html>
```
在这个示例中,<!doctype html>声明位于HTML文档的第一行。它告诉浏览器使用HTML5版本来解析页面。接下来的代码是HTML文档的结构,包括<head>元素和<body>元素。在<body>元素中,我们可以添加各种HTML标记,如标题(<h1>)和段落(<p>)。
相关问题
解释每行代码的意思<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title>菜鸟教程(runoob.com)</title> </head> <body> <table width="500" border="0"> <tr> <td colspan="2" style="background-color:#FFA500;"> <h1>主要的网页标题</h1> </td> </tr> <tr> <td style="background-color:#FFD700;width:100px;vertical-align:top;"> <b>菜单</b><br> HTML<br> CSS<br> JavaScript </td> <td style="background-color:#eeeeee;height:200px;width:400px;vertical-align:top;"> 内容在这里</td> </tr> <tr> <td colspan="2" style="background-color:#FFA500;text-align:center;"> 版权 © runoob.com</td> </tr> </table> </body> </html>
这是一个 HTML 网页文件,其中每个标签都有特定的意义:
- `<!DOCTYPE html>`:告诉浏览器这是一个 HTML5 文件。
- `<html>`:开始 HTML 文档。
- `<head>`:文档的头部,包含了一些元数据,如字符编码、标题等。
- `<meta charset="utf-8">`:定义字符编码为 UTF-8。
- `<title>菜鸟教程(runoob.com)</title>`:文档的标题。
- `</head>`:头部结束。
- `<body>`:文档的主体部分。
- `<table width="500" border="0">`:创建一个宽度为 500 像素,无边框的表格。
- `<tr>`:表格中的行。
- `<td colspan="2" style="background-color:#FFA500;">`:表格中的单元格,跨越两列,背景颜色为橙色。
- `<h1>主要的网页标题</h1>`:一级标题,居中显示在表格单元格中。
- `</td>`:单元格结束。
- `</tr>`:行结束。
- `<tr>`:新的一行。
- `<td style="background-color:#FFD700;width:100px;vertical-align:top;">`:表格单元格,背景颜色为金色,宽度为 100 像素,垂直对齐方式为顶部。
- `<b>菜单</b><br> HTML<br> CSS<br> JavaScript </td>`:单元格中的内容,粗体的“菜单”字样和三个菜单项。
- `<td style="background-color:#eeeeee;height:200px;width:400px;vertical-align:top;"> 内容在这里</td>`:另一个表格单元格,灰色背景色,高度为 200 像素,宽度为 400 像素,顶部对齐。
- `</tr>`:行结束。
- `<tr>`:新的一行。
- `<td colspan="2" style="background-color:#FFA500;text-align:center;">`:跨越两列的单元格,背景颜色为橙色,文本居中对齐。
- `版权 © runoob.com</td>`:单元格中的文本。
- `</tr>`:行结束。
- `</table>`:表格结束。
- `</body>`:文档主体结束。
- `</html>`:HTML 文档结束。
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Document</title> </head> <body> <script src="https://unpkg.com/vue@3/dist/vue.global.js"></script> <div id="app"><ComponentA /> </div> <script> const app = Vue.createApp({}); app.component("ComponentA", { template: ` <div>1111111111</div>`, }); app.mount("#app"); </script> </body> </html> 提示组件为注册
这是一段包含 Vue.js 框架的 HTML 代码。它创建了一个 Vue 实例,然后定义了一个名为 "ComponentA" 的组件。在组件的模板中,它只包含了一个 `<div>` 标签,里面显示着文本 "1111111111"。最后,通过调用 `app.mount("#app")` 方法将 Vue 实例挂载到 HTML 中的一个 id 为 "app" 的元素上。
至于你的问题是什么,我没有看到你提出具体的问题,不知道你需要我回答什么。如果你还有其他问题,可以继续提出来。
阅读全文